How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bloomington?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Bloomington Studio Apartments Under $3000 | $1,107 | $549 | $2,321 |
| Bloomington 1 Bedroom Apartments Under $3000 | $1,384 | $695 | $2,040 |
| Bloomington 2 Bedroom Apartments Under $3000 | $1,539 | $725 | $3,000 |
| Bloomington 3 Bedroom Apartments Under $3000 | $1,927 | $699 | $5,578 |
| Bloomington 4 Bedroom Apartments Under $3000 | $1,558 | $785 | $4,400 |
| Bloomington 5 Bedroom Apartments | $2,495 | $899 | $6,900 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Bloomington
How much are Studio apartments in Bloomington?
There are currently 70 Studio Apartments in Bloomington with rent ranges from $549 to $2,321 with an average price of $1,107.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Bloomington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Bloomington ranges from $695 to $2,040 with an average monthly rent of $1,384.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Bloomington c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Bloomington range from $725 to $3,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,539.
How expensive are Bloomington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 130 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Bloomington on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$699 to $5,578 - averaging $1,927 for the location.
